编程中百分比的类型是什么
-
在编程中,百分比的类型可以使用两种方式表示:整数和浮点数。
-
整数类型:在某些编程语言中,可以使用整数来表示百分比。例如,可以将百分比转换为整数,例如将50%表示为50。这种表示方法比较简单,适用于整数运算,但在一些情况下可能会引起精度丢失的问题。
-
浮点数类型:另一种常见的表示百分比的方式是使用浮点数。浮点数是一种带有小数部分的数值类型,可以更准确地表示百分比。例如,可以将50%表示为0.5。使用浮点数表示百分比可以进行更精确的计算和比较。
在编程中,选择使用整数还是浮点数来表示百分比取决于具体的需求和使用场景。如果只需要简单的百分比表示和计算,整数类型可能足够。但如果需要更高的精度和准确性,或者需要进行复杂的百分比计算,浮点数类型可能更合适。
需要注意的是,在进行百分比计算时,还需要注意处理小数点的位置和精度,以避免计算错误或误差积累。在某些编程语言中,也提供了特定的百分比类型或库,用于更方便地处理百分比计算。
1年前 -
-
编程中,常见的百分比的类型有以下几种:
-
整数百分比(Integer Percentage):整数百分比是最常见的百分比类型,表示一个数值相对于另一个数值的百分比。例如,某个商品打折50%,表示商品的价格是原价的一半。
-
小数百分比(Decimal Percentage):小数百分比是指百分比值以小数形式表示,通常是在计算过程中得到的结果。例如,某个学生在考试中获得的分数是80,满分是100,那么他的成绩可以表示为80%或0.8。
-
百分比增长率(Percentage Growth Rate):百分比增长率是指相对于原始值的增长量所占原始值的百分比。例如,某个城市的人口从100万增长到120万,增长的人口数是20万,那么增长率可以表示为20%。
-
百分比差异(Percentage Difference):百分比差异是指两个数值之间的差异所占其中一个数值的百分比。例如,某个月份的销售额为1000万元,上个月的销售额为800万元,那么差异可以表示为25%。
-
百分比比较(Percentage Comparison):百分比比较是指将一个数值与另一个数值进行比较,并以百分比形式表示两者的关系。例如,某个国家的贫困率是20%,而另一个国家的贫困率是15%,那么可以说第一个国家的贫困率高于第二个国家的贫困率。
1年前 -
-
在编程中,百分比可以表示为不同的数据类型,具体取决于编程语言和应用场景。以下是一些常见的百分比类型:
-
整数类型:在某些编程语言中,百分比可以表示为整数类型。例如,在Java中,可以使用整数类型(例如int)来存储百分比值。例如,如果要表示50%,可以将其存储为整数50。
-
浮点类型:在其他编程语言中,百分比可以表示为浮点类型。浮点数可以精确地表示小数和分数值,因此可以用于表示非整数的百分比。例如,在Python中,可以使用浮点类型(例如float)来存储百分比值。例如,要表示50%,可以将其存储为0.5。
-
字符串类型:有时候,在编程中百分比也可以表示为字符串类型。这种情况通常在需要将百分比值作为文本输出时使用。例如,在JavaScript中,可以将百分比表示为字符串,如"50%"。
无论使用哪种数据类型,编程中处理百分比的方法通常是相似的。可以使用数学运算符和函数来进行百分比计算,例如乘法、除法和格式化函数。以下是一些常见的操作流程:
-
将百分比转换为小数:在进行百分比计算时,通常需要将百分比值转换为小数。这可以通过将百分比值除以100来实现。例如,要将50%转换为小数,可以将其除以100,得到0.5。
-
将小数转换为百分比:如果需要将小数转换回百分比值,可以将小数乘以100。例如,将0.5乘以100可以得到50%。
-
计算百分比:可以使用乘法和除法运算符来计算两个数之间的百分比。例如,如果要计算一个数值占另一个数值的百分比,可以将第一个数值除以第二个数值,然后将结果乘以100。例如,如果要计算80是100的百分之多少,可以计算80除以100,然后乘以100,得到80%。
-
格式化百分比:在输出百分比时,通常需要将其格式化为特定的样式。可以使用格式化函数或字符串操作来实现。例如,在Python中,可以使用字符串的format()方法来格式化百分比输出。
需要注意的是,百分比的表示和计算方法可能会因编程语言和应用场景而有所不同。因此,在具体编程时,应查阅相关文档和参考资料以了解特定编程语言中百分比的表示方法和操作流程。
1年前 -